RECOMMENDATION
The Illinois Environmental Protection Agency (“Illinois EPA”) hereby files its
Recommendation regarding the tax certification of water pollution control facilities pursuant to
pursuant to Section 125.204 of the regulations of the Illinois Pollution Control Board, 35 Ill.
Adm. Code 125.204.
1.
On December 30, 2002 the Illinois EPA received a request from Hilleson Farms (log
number TC 3 0-02, Exhibit A) for a recommendation regarding the tax certification of
water pollution control facilities, pursuant to 35 III. Adm. Code 125.204.
2.
The applicant’s address is: John Hilleson
Hilleson Farms
1306 PawPaw Road
Lee Illinois 60530
3.
The proposed water pollution control facilities in this request are located in Section 10,
T38N, Range 2E of the 3rd Principal Meridian, Lee County at the above address, and
consist of the following livestock waste management facilities:
One concrete manure pit
(51
ft. x 225 ft. x 6 ft. deep) and the slotted•concrete
portion ofthe floor located over the manure pit in one swine finisher building.
These livestock waste management facilities, which• are used to collect, transport and/or
store livestock wastes prior to cropland application, are further described in Exhibit A.

4.
Section 11-10 of the Property Tax Code, 35 ILCS 200/11-10, defines “pollution control
facilities” as:
“any system, method, construction, device or appliance appurtenant thereto or any
portion of any building or equipment, that is designed, constructed, installed or
operated for the primary purpose of: (a) eliminating, preventing, or reducing air or
water pollution
. . .
or (b) treating, pretreating, modifying or disposing of any
potential solid, liquid or gaseous pollutant which if released without treatment,
pretreatment modification or disposal might be harmful, detrimental or offensive
to human, plant or animal life, or to property.”
5.
Pollution control facilities are entitled to preferential tax treatment, 35 ILCS 200/11-5.
6.
Based on the ~nformation in the application and the purpose of the facilities, it is the
Illinois EPA’s engineering judgment that the described facilities may be considered
“pollution control facilities,” pursuant to 35 Ill. Adrn. Code 125.200(a), with the primary
purpose of eliminating, preventing, or reducing water pollution, or as otherwise provided
in 35 Ill. Adm. Code 125 .200, and are eligible for tax certification from the Board.
WI-JEREFORE, the Illinois EPA recommends that the Board grant the requested
tax certification.

The Department has received a certification
notice from the owner or operator relative to the
completion of construction of a non-lagoon livestock waste handling structure at the aforementioned
facility. The certification indicates that the waste handling structure has been constructed or modified
in accordance with the requirements of the Livestock Management Facilities Act (Act) (510 ILCS
77/I et seq.) and rules and that the information provided during the registration process is correct.
On December 18, 2001, Department representatives conducted a final inspection at the facility
pursuant to the Livestock Management Facilities Act (510 ILCS 77/13 (g)). No deviations from the
construction plan were noted during the inspection. Inspections of the facility were also conducted
prior to and during the construction phase of the project.
Pursuant to the Section 13 of the Livestock Management Facilities Act, the construction plan and
certification requirements of the Act have been met. The owner or operator oftile livestock waste
handling facility may proceed to place the structure into service.
